WebApr 12, 2024 · Here is what I recommend you do for a long-term solution to moss growth in your lawn: Work on lessening the shade. This may require removing some tree limbs to allow more sunlight to reach the ground. This will also allow more air movement in the area. With more sunlight and air movement, hopefully, the soil will have the natural ability to dry ...
